A man has been arrested after a delivery driver was robbed in Gorton last night. Police were called to Darras Road just after 9pm on Saturday night (June 11) following reports of the robbery.

Officers attended the scene alongside crews from North West Ambulance Service. A 25-year-old man was taken to hospital after suffering minor injuries. Police are appealing for anyone with information to come forward. The road was closed for a number of hours while a number of police vehicles were pictured at the scene.

Residents were seen behind the tape as investigations continued, with CID cops also in attendance. A GMP spokesperson said: “Officers were called just after 9pm last night (11 June 2022) to a report of a robbery on a delivery driver on Darras Road in Manchester.
